Most Vauxhall automobiles are equipped with a transponder in the key. This chip responds when the immobiliser system of the vehicle requests it. If the response is incorrect the system will stop the engine from beginning. It is essential to locate an expert locksmith for Vauxhall if you have lost your Vauxhall key. They will be able to program the new key for your vehicle.
Certain Vauxhall models come with proximity keys. These keys let you start your car by pressing one button. They also unlock doors and turn on ignition. These are a little more expensive than standard Vauxhall keys, but offer additional security and convenience.
The price of a Vauxhall replacement key depends on the year and model of your vehicle. The cost of replacing a key with a transponder will be higher than a standard key. The cost increase is due to the fact that a transponder chip requires special equipment to program.
If you have a manual vauxhall combo key replacement car key the transponder chip will be located in the head's top part of plastic that you hold. If you have a Vauxhall remote locking key the transponder chip is typically located in the horseshoe blade. It is not unusual for the horseshoe fitting and the remote to come apart and result in the transponder chip getting lost.
To replace a Vauxhall key, you will have to give your vehicle identification number (VIN) to the locksmith. The VIN can be found in the owner's manual or the dashboard of your car. The locksmith will need to use a tool to extract the security codes from the memory of the vehicle which will allow them to program keys.
